AI and Ethics: Navigating the Digital Minefield
Introduction
The rise of artificial intelligence (AI) has sparked significant discussions around ethics in technology. As AI systems become more integrated into daily life, understanding the ethical implications is crucial.
The Challenges of AI Ethics
From bias in algorithms to data privacy concerns, the challenges surrounding AI are vast. Companies need to navigate these issues with care to avoid ethical pitfalls.
Establishing Ethical Guidelines
Many organizations are now developing ethical guidelines to govern AI use. This includes ensuring transparency in how AI systems make decisions and safeguarding user privacy.
Case Studies
Several high-profile incidents have demonstrated the need for strong ethical standards in AI, including biased recruitment tools and controversial facial recognition technologies.
